I have just had a meeting with Silverstone Insurance about the club scheme.
The policies will be underwritten by Norwich Union. Most mods and track cover are OK and they will give £35 off the lowest price we can get out of them (by way of a voucher that we will give to every club member).
We will have a dedicated number to call, early next week, and full details will be in the next issue of True Grip.
I should add, that you will be asked for your SIDC member number when calling and the scheme will only be available for club members.
Please don't post loads of questions here, there isn't more to add. The rest will be between you and them, when you call.

Called the number this morning, they answered "Hill House Hammond"...?!
Mentioned SIDC, seemed to cause all sorts of confusion "who are the FDC?" "Why do we need your membership number?", but seemed to work out OK, and they took my Membership Number eventually.
(Put on hold several times: muzac seemed to be a badly cut copy of the first 15 seconds intro of Elton John, "sacrifice" )
They'd never heard of Trackstar, didn't know it was a tracking device
(more terrible elton john intros)
quote took a little longer than "normal" because they had to run it through "the special scheme"
(muzac again: aaaaargh)
Best quote they could provide was £1403, 600XS for me and my P1 (unmodified, not garaged, dodgy postcode, full NCB, one conviction)
Best quote to date has been Greenlight, £1100 with a £400XS
Thanks for arranging the scheme and at least providing the option, though Pete
Cameron
